di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/postgre_sql_management_client_enums.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/postgre_sql_management_client_enums.py
index 113c45c3c003..58b3c8ce4f2b 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/postgre_sql_management_client_enums.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/postgre_sql_management_client_enums.py
@@ -16,6 +16,9 @@ class ServerVersion(str, Enum):
 
     nine_full_stop_five = "9.5"
     nine_full_stop_six = "9.6"
+    one_zero = "10"
+    one_zero_full_stop_zero = "10.0"
+    one_zero_full_stop_two = "10.2"
 
 
 class SslEnforcementEnum(str, Enum):
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server.py
index be0aabcb6fa4..4ba9b5b3df1d 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server.py
@@ -36,7 +36,8 @@ class Server(TrackedResource):
      Can only be specified when the server is being created (and is required
      for creation).
     :type administrator_login: str
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create.py
index 8c9b8a45eb69..5ab135d7a54e 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create.py
@@ -21,7 +21,8 @@ class ServerPropertiesForCreate(Model):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create_py3.py
index 5983a5bff36d..24e5f64e6511 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_create_py3.py
@@ -21,7 +21,8 @@ class ServerPropertiesForCreate(Model):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create.py
index 89d145f48dc1..da6fd136fecf 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create.py
@@ -17,7 +17,8 @@ class ServerPropertiesForDefaultCreate(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create_py3.py
index 0fb43758d0da..3cef4094aa1c 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_default_create_py3.py
@@ -17,7 +17,8 @@ class ServerPropertiesForDefaultCreate(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ore.py
index ccd84f7330fb..195d1fe26c04 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ore.py
@@ -18,7 +18,8 @@ class ServerPropertiesForGeoRestore(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ore_py3.py
index 91c47cc1418a..bc8ac2dd410f 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_geo_restore_py3.py
@@ -18,7 +18,8 @@ class ServerPropertiesForGeoRestore(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ore.py
index 31ea1129095d..95559a5fe787 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ore.py
@@ -17,7 +17,8 @@ class ServerPropertiesForRestore(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ore_py3.py
index c6ff05ab6077..29afafba30c4 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_properties_for_restore_py3.py
@@ -17,7 +17,8 @@ class ServerPropertiesForRestore(ServerPropertiesForCreate):
 
     All required parameters must be populated in order to send to Azure.
 
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_py3.py
index 29cafa54507d..39e4dd240528 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_py3.py
@@ -36,7 +36,8 @@ class Server(TrackedResource):
      Can only be specified when the server is being created (and is required
      for creation).
     :type administrator_login: str
-    :param version: Server version. Possible values include: '9.5', '9.6'
+    :param version: Server version. Possible values include: '9.5', '9.6',
+     '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ters.py
index f806ed2151a7..98fdfa2e6b76 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ters.py
@@ -23,7 +23,7 @@ class ServerUpdateParameters(Model):
      login.
     :type administrator_login_password: str
     :param version: The version of a server. Possible values include: '9.5',
-     '9.6'
+     '9.6', '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'
diff --git a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ters_py3.py b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ters_py3.py
index f7f3a6a1b00b..cdcedce754c5 100644
--- a/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ters_py3.py
+++ b/azure-mgmt-rdbms/azure/mgmt/rdbms/postgresql/models/server_update_parameters_py3.py
@@ -23,7 +23,7 @@ class ServerUpdateParameters(Model):
      login.
     :type administrator_login_password: str
     :param version: The version of a server. Possible values include: '9.5',
-     '9.6'
+     '9.6', '10', '10.0', '10.2'
     :type version: str or ~azure.mgmt.rdbms.postgresql.models.ServerVersion
     :param ssl_enforcement: Enable ssl enforcement or not when connect to
      server. Possible values include: 'Enabled', 'Disabled'